Description

Situated on a quite cul-de-sac on the favoured south side of town, within Grammar School catchment, this fantastic mid-terrace house is within walking distance of shops, bars and restaurants in the town centre as well as closer shops on Leeds Road.
41 St George’s Walk has been beautifully maintained by the current owners and briefly comprises; a welcoming entrance hall, a generous and light living room with under stairs storage cupboard overlooking the front garden and opening through into a newly fitted modern kitchen with dining area, induction hob, oven, space for a washing machine and tall freestanding fridge freezer. To the first floor are two excellent double bedrooms - one with built in cupboard and further built in wardrobes - both serviced by a tiled house bathroom. There is also a boarded loft with light and ladder.

The property is fronted by a beautiful lawned garden with colourful planted borders, mature bushes and garden path. There is also a single garage with storage, electric point and pitched roof space, with a driveway for two cars in front. To the rear of the property is a privately enclosed, south facing garden with patio, crunch gravel, planted borders and established plants. Creating a real sun trap that leads straight out from the kitchen - ideal for entertaining with family and friends.
